Other than those digimon I wrote in the post for this strategy, I would like to use the Omnimon from BT5 (3 copies) to take benefit of Shingeki (Blitz) to attack when it evolves. Since our strategy is to build more LV6 under its digivolution source, this Omnimon can take advantage of this build and stay longer in the battle.

The LV3 Shoutmon is used to reveal cards and take to hand 1 digimon with [Shoutmon] in its name and 1 digimon with Blitz, this will help shorting the hands and deck. If we able to build the digivolution base for ShoutmonDX or ZekeGreymon that includes Shoutmon and OmniShoutmon, it adds 2000DP and SecurityAttack+1. We can do attacking security first then digivolve to LV7 BT5 Omnimon, unsuspend this Omnimon and do another attack (this is considered as another plan incase we cannot draw BT1 Omnimon at this turn). Up till this point, it already checked 4 securities.

The LV5 Vermilimon – 5 cost to play, to use in case we cannot draw low cost LV6, and 3 copies of Phoenixmon (10 cost to play and 2 cost to digivolve). I also use 2 copies of white Tamer Tai Kamiya&Matt Ishida to gain 2 memory when opponent has LV6 digimon or higher. Since we are giving opponent a alots of memory, there is high chance that they will move up to LV6 or LV7.

Final Point.

By the first look, you might think this deck dont prepare "defense" strategy. Actually, with the Takumi Aiba and Shoutmon DX, I really dont worry if opponent does rushing. Draw power are also supported by blue LV3 Veemon and Takumi Aiba, the LV3 Shoutmon gives more support to get "blitz" cards (ZekeGreymon, Shoutmon DX and BT5 Omnimon). We can get more memory from red option card Gravity Crush and white tamer Tai&Matt.
